1. Ueda Electric Railway Bessho LineThe Bessho Line is a Japanese railway line, between Ueda and Bessho-Onsen stations, all within Ueda, Nagano. This is currently the only railway line Ueda Electric Railway operates. The first section of the line opened in 1921. Although the company is the root of its holding company, Ueda Kōtsū, the group now mainly operates resort amusement facilities and bus lines. Ueda Kōtsū group belongs to Tōkyū Corporation.
